From: Qu Wenruo Date: Sat, 9 Aug 2025 04:40:48 +0000 (+0930) Subject: btrfs: simplify support block size check X-Git-Tag: v6.18-rc1~204^2~95 X-Git-Url: http://git.ipfire.org/?a=commitdiff_plain;h=d728f2e5f8a075756ce60410c1ecb3a0b61f2bf8;p=thirdparty%2Fkernel%2Fstable.git btrfs: simplify support block size check Currently we manually check the block size against 3 different values: - 4K - PAGE_SIZE - MIN_BLOCKSIZE Those 3 values can match or differ from each other. This makes it pretty complex to output the supported block sizes. Considering we're going to add block size > page size support soon, this can make the support block size sysfs attribute much harder to implement. To make it easier, factor out a helper, btrfs_supported_blocksize() to do a simple check for the block size. Then utilize it in the two locations: - btrfs_validate_super() This is very straightforward - supported_sectorsizes_show() Iterate through all valid block sizes, and only output supported ones. This is to make future full range block sizes support much easier.
